Madalina Cojocari was seen walking off a school bus on Nov. 21, 2022. Her mother, Diana Cojocari, last saw her at their Cornelius home on Nov. 23, but her mother didn’t report her missing until Dec. 15 -- 22 days later.
1678311925178.jpeg
In a search warrant dated Feb. 14, investigators said they interviewed one of Diana Cojocari’s distant relatives. He said Diana and her mother asked him if he would help Diana with “smuggling” her and Madalina away from the home. The relative said Diana told him she was in a “bad relationship” with her husband, Christopher Palmiter, and wanted a divorce.
1678311967155.jpeg
Police said on Feb. 10, Cornelius detectives and North Carolina State Bureau of Investigation agents reviewed Diana Cojocari’s phone records. They discovered she had extensive communication on Dec. 2 with that relative who police interviewed.

Investigators said they reviewed the relative’s phone records as well and found “multiple calls to phone numbers belonging to unidentified targets involved in ongoing T3 drug/narcotic trafficking investigations.”

“T3″ or “TIII” in this context means wiretap, Channel 9 has learned.
1678312015220.jpeg
The newly-released court documents include search warrants and notes from investigators that show a K-9 police dog “alerted” — meaning may have detected — the scent of narcotics on Diana Cojocari’s car on Feb. 10. The car is in police possession, the records state.

Previous arrest records released by the courts show that on the night Madalina disappeared, her parents were fighting. Her mother told investigators she believed her husband, Madalina’s step father, put their family in danger. She also told police she did not report her daughter missing sooner because she feared “conflict” with him.

The court records related to the search of Cojocari’s car are dated Feb. 13 and 14.

Investigators searched Diana Cojocari’s Green 2008 Toyota Prius and seized Madalina’s Moldovan and Romanian passports, Diana’s Romanian passport, a Moldovan debit card, and “miscellaneous education certificates and work documents,” court records indicate. All of these items were found in the car’s center console, police wrote.

TIMELINE UPDATES in RED
(I stepped a way for a few days for the holidays; please @ me with links if I missed anything!)


M = Madalina Cojocari, 11-year-old missing from home at 18413 Victoria Bay Rd, Cornelius, NC
SDadCP = stepfather Christopher Palmiter
MomDC = mother Diana Cojocari; extended family are “well-known and well-connected musicians in Moldova” [25]; father is a teacher and mother an accountant [31]

----------------------------------------

~2011
M is born

2014
MomDC participates in Eastern European weight loss TV show; gets engaged during filming to SDadCP, whom she did not know prior [27]

JUL 8, 2020
MomDC posts FB video with comment "Is something wrong of being violent?" - VIDEO

? OCT (“end of October”)
MomDC and M last communicated with M’s grandfather (MomDC’s father) in Moldova [22]

W NOV 16
According to SDadCP, this was the last time he saw M [15]

M NOV 21 - MADALINA COJOCARI LAST SEEN ------------------------------------------------------------------
According to school counselor, this was the last time M attended school [15] - cf T NOV 22
4:59PM - M recorded disembarking from school bus at her stop [18]
View attachment 389079

SOMETIME BETWEEN T NOV 22 TO Th DEC 15
According to CPD, “one of the family members [MomDC] was in the Madison County area of NC” with a Toyota Prius between 22 Nov and 15 Dec [32]; deputy stopped to check on her at pull-off area west of Marshall, near Lonesome Mountain; M was not in the vehicle [33]


T NOV 22 - DAY 1
MC attended classes at Bailey Middle School [10] - cf M NOV 21
12PM - According to MomDC's report on Dec 15, M was missing since this time [16] - cf W NOV 23
[TIME?] - MomDC's vehicle reportedly seen in Weaverville, NC [35]

W NOV 23 - DAY 2
NO SCHOOL [4]
[PM] - M last seen at home [1] at 10PM [10] by MomDC when M went to bed [12] - cf T NOV 22
[PM] - According to MomDC, she and SDadCP had an argument that night [12]

Th NOV 24 - DAY 3
THANKSGIVING - NO SCHOOL [4]
[AM] - According to MomDC, SDadCP drove to Michigan to "recover some items"; he claims he did not see M before he left [12]
11:30AM - According to MomDC, she woke up feeling sick, as if she’d been under anesthesia [31] and when she went to check on M, she was gone [12] but that she’d been looking for her “non-stop” since then [31]

F NOV 25 - DAY 4
NO SCHOOL [4]
[TIME?] - MomDC's vehicle reportedly seen in Weaverville, NC at an IHOP [35]

Sa NOV 26 - DAY 5

7PM - According to MomDC, SDadCP returned from his trip to Michigan and she asked him if he knew where M was, but he did not; she did not make missing persons report because she was "worried to might start a conflict" between her and SDadCP; he claims that he asked MomDC then and in weeks following if she had "hidden" M from him [12]

Su NOV 27 - DAY 6
[PM] According to neighbors, there were fires burning in the yard at the residence "at all hours" beginning on this day [19@2:22]; items burned included couch cushions; Cornelius FD chief acknowledges blaze but can’t comment on it [26*]

F DEC 2 - DAY 11
MomDC has extensive communication with a "known subject" in "ongoing T3 drug/narcotic trafficking investigations"; asked for help in "smuggling" her and MC away from residence [36]


M DEC 12 - DAY 21
2PM [17] - SRO tried to make a home visit to address M's truancy, but no one answered at residence [12]; truancy packet was left [15]

T DEC 13 - DAY 22
[TIME?] - Around this date (“Roughly, I don’t know, 13, 14”) MomDC cried on the phone to her sister AuntCP, stating that she was afraid SDadCP was listening to her phone conversations, knew M was gone but did not know where, and that when she had woken up on W 23 NOV, she’d felt sick, like she’d been waking up from anesthesia [31]

W DEC 14 - DAY 23
[TIME?] - MomDC calls school counselor and schedules meeting to discuss truancy, saying she will bring M [15]

Th DEC 15 - REPORTED MISSING - DAY 24
1:15PM - M reported missing to Bailey Middle School SRO by "parents" [1] MomDC supposed to bring M to meeting at school about truancy but arrived without her, claiming that she did not know where M was [12]

F DEC 16 - DAY 25
[PM] FBI, SBI searching residence, "spent hours digging in the ground in her backyard, and searching for evidence inside the home" [3]

Sa DEC 17 - SDadCP & MomDC ARRESTED - DAY 26
[TIME?] during visit to home [on this date?], LE note that kitchen was blocked off; SDadCP claimed it was to create another apartment [20]
12:29AM [6] - SDadCP arrested for failure to report disappearance of child, held on $100k bond [2]
[AM] According to neighbors, there were fires burning in the yard at residence up to this time [19@2:22]
10:12AM - MomDC arrested for failure to report disappearance of child, held on $100k bond [7]; stated that she “believed her husband put her family in danger”; family in Moldova had told her to call the police but she did not; stated that a bookbag with clothes was missing [20]

Su DEC 18 - DAY 27
[PM] - FBI, SBI, CPD return to residence, collect evidence, bring in K9 unit, tow vehicle [8]
View attachment 388683

M DEC 19 - DAY 28
[AM] - Search includes Lake Cornelius/Lake Davidson [9]
[AM] - SDadCP appears in court, bond increased to $200k [9]; represented by public defender; both parents state they do not know where M is [11]

T DEC 20 - DAY 29
[AM] - MomDC appears in court [9]; bond increased to $250k [13]; electronic monitoring will be required should she makes bond [14]
7PM - Prayer vigil held in common area near home [10][21]

W DEC 21 - DAY 30
AM - Interview with MomDC’s father in Moldova published [22] - cf ? OCT
5PM - Cornelius PD return to residence, possibly taking photos [23]

Th DEC 22 - DAY 31
AM - Members of M’s extended (Palmiter [25]) family release letter requesting public’s help in finding her [24]
7PM - Prayer vigil held at Cornelius Town Square [10]

F DEC 23 - DAY 32
PM - SDadCP’s FB page updated with new profile pic, removal of other info [27]

SOMETIME BETWEEN T DEC 27 and F JAN 6
LE canvassing in Madison County; search dogs spotted along Lonesome Mountain Road [33]


T DEC 27 - DAY 36
PM - Cornelius PD release video update - states it is a “serious case of a child whose parents clearly are not telling us everything they know”[30]

W DEC 28 - DAY 37
PM - COURT DATE: Bond hearings for SDadCP & MomDC scheduled [25] - not held [29]
PM - New bond conditions agreed upon with judge [29]
  • If released, MomDC and SDadCP will surrender their passports [29]
  • If released, SDadCP would also be required to wear an electronic monitoring device [29] (already a condition for MomDC - cf T Dec 20) [29]
F DEC 30 - DAY 39
Warrants for Dec 21 search of residence temporarily sealed [33] - cf T Jan 10

F JAN 6 - DAY 46
LE asks for info about anyone seeing MomDC or Prius in Madison County (about 3hrs from M’s home) between Nov 22 and Dec 15 [33]

T JAN 10 - DAY 50
Warrants for search of residence unsealed [34] - cf F Dec 30

Detectives state in the warrant application it’s possible “persons associated with narcotics activity are also associated with human smuggling.” “A search of the residence may locate drugs and/or money not previously found in the residence,” the detective applying for the warrant wrote making a note that a K-9 would be needed. “We believe that an additional search could be helpful in locating and leading to information on the disappearance of Madalina Cojocari.”

Madalina missed nearly three weeks of school and on Dec. 15 Cojocari reported Madalina missing during a meeting with the school about the absences. Since she was reported missing, police have searched her home repeatedly, combed Lake Cornelius, and asked residents of Madison County to come forward with information placing her parents in the area around the dates she disappeared. Detectives said they believed Cojocari was in the area sometime between Nov. 22 and Dec. 15. Cojocari and Palmiter are expected in court on May 11.
